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
53 170568 3951 08269121653
079760 2527539
079760 2527539
6984465 08631 1817
All about undefined
Interested in learning more?
079760 2527539
6984465 08631 1817
See more
0286 769618
400487 1916880762 93 4462950905 207619737
See more
1444246 7601
091952103 08108 1128206
See more